Lisa Aschan
Director Lisa Aschan graduated from The National Film School of Denmark 2005. While still in school, she received attention for Fuck the rapist, a collection of fictional advertisements for spiked tampons designed to protect against rape.
Aschan is known for her suggestive visual language, naturalistic direction, and unique talent for telling a story in actions instead of words. She sees filmmaking as a way to explore the world, not simply give it form.
Her films In transit and Goodbye bluebird have been shown in film festivals around the world. She has created and directed a drama series for the Danish TV channel DR1, attended the Royal Institute of Art, and worked at the Royal Dramatic Theatre.
She Monkeys is her first feature film.
